Source name peripheral blood
Organism Homo sapiens
Characteristics cell type: macrophages derived from CD14+ monocytes
treatment: co-cultured with apoptotic Jurkat T cells
Treatment protocol Human macrophages were stimulated with apoptotic Jurkat cells at a 1:3 ratio in 6-well plates for 3 hours. Upon efferocytosis, non-phagocytosed cells were removed and macrophages were washed 3x with PBS, followed by incubation with RPMI 1640 supplemented with 10% heat-inactivated FCS, 100 U/mL penicillin, and 100 μg/mL streptomycin for 3 hours.
Growth protocol CD14+ monocytes isolated from human buffy coats and differentiated into macrophages in macrophage serum-free medium supplemented with 100 U/mL penicillin, 100 μg/mL streptomycin, and 50 ng/mL of macrophage colony-stimulating factor (M-CSF) for 7 days followed by culture in RPMI 1640 medium supplemented with 10% heat-inactivated FCS, 100 U/mL penicillin, and 100 μg/mL streptomycin
Extracted molecule total RNA
Extraction protocol Total RNA of non-treated and efferocytotic macrophages was isolated using RNeasy Micro Kit (Qiagen) according to the manufacturer’s protocol
Libraries were prepared using QuantSeq 3’ mRNA-Seq Library Prep Kit FWD from Illumina (Lexogen)
